For 75 years UWFRA has been rescuing people and animals from the caves, mineshafts, fells and crags of Wharfedale, Nidderdale, Littondale and Mid-Airedale. Our rescue services remain free to all who need us, day or night and are financed entirely by fundraising events and donations.
To call a rescue team
Call 999, ask for the Police,
Ask the Police for Cave or Fell rescue,
Say where you are, give description and grid reference
Describe the problem
Stay near a phone or where your mobile works.
